CVE-2009-3924
Last modified
CVE-2009-3924 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. Buffer overflow in pbsv.dll, as used in Soldier of Fortune II and possibly other applications when Even Balance PunkBuster 1.728 or earlier is enabled,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application server cr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via a long restart packet.. EPSS estimates a 3.95%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
